Hii Vivek
General practice is that the name, signature,age,occupation,address,father's name,no of shares held by the subcribers to MOA & AOA is verified by an independent professional,who is generally a Company Secretary in whole time practice.

No compulsion regarding independent professional for sure.
Signature of subscribers of Memorandum and articles of association may be witnessed by any person having contractual eligibility along with a professional....but preferably by the person involved with the incorporation process.
